Tsuuga
01-31-2007, 10:05 PM
Is the epic part of the story that they travel around?

Uh, not really, but that's part of it. The scope of the story seems so large, and their actions have very widespread consequences. They stop a giant civil war and save hundreds of thousands of Alabasta citizens, journey to an island in the sky and stop its destruction, and they ride a sea train to a floating island fortress to save a crewmate.

Each land they travel to is very unique and has its own interesting stories in it.
